sure you dont already have it on already? check the router stats.

if not, you would likely be on FAST mode for a reason - your line is stable.

Interleaving is designed to make slightly unstable lines a bit better by breaking up data, if you aren't experiancing packet loss or any troubles, I would stick with FAST mode for now as you will just have a slower speed with interleaving on.

Otherwise.

Go to www.bt.com/contactus and fill in an enquiry form for a normal technical enquiry, they will need to contact Wholesale and request it is done so will take 48 hrs. If they dont do it/get back to you, fill in a complaint form, but at least give them a chance to do it for you before complaining smile
